Webbponcho, article of clothing of ancient origin, a cloak made of a square or rectangle of cloth with a hole in the middle through which the wearer’s head protrudes. Webb11 aug. 2024 · Wearing a Salasaka poncho means embracing the indigenous culture and the mother’s or wife’s gift. The process lasts three days. During the process the poncho steeping men share their happiness and the women share the delicious traditional foods.
